The Top Speed: A Glimpse at the Numbers

On a typical, fairly flat dirt oval, a dirt midget can reach speeds in the ballpark of 100 to 130 miles per hour. However, this is often achieved on the straights. The real magic happens in the corners, where drivers are masterfully controlling these machines at incredibly high speeds, often sideways and inches from the wall. The G-forces at play in the corners are immense, showcasing the driver's skill as much as the car's capability.

Factors Influencing Dirt Midget Speed

Several critical elements come into play when determining how fast a dirt midget can truly perform:

  • Track Configuration: The length and banking of the track play a huge role. Longer, wider tracks with more banking allow for higher sustained speeds. Short, flat tracks will naturally limit top-end speed due to tighter turns and less momentum carrying.
  • Engine Power: Dirt midgets are powered by potent engines, typically V6 or V8, producing anywhere from 300 to over 400 horsepower. The specific engine build and tuning significantly impact acceleration and top speed.
  • Tire Compound and Pressure: The tires are the only point of contact with the dirt, and their condition, compound, and pressure are meticulously managed. Different track conditions (dry, slick, wet) necessitate different tire strategies to maximize grip and therefore speed.
  • Aerodynamics: While not as dominant as in open-wheel road racing, the bodywork of a midget is designed to provide some downforce, helping keep the car planted at speed, especially in the corners.
  • Weight: Dirt midgets are designed to be lightweight, which is crucial for quick acceleration and nimble handling.
  • Driver Skill: This cannot be overstated. A skilled driver can extract more speed from a midget than an average driver, not just by going faster in a straight line, but by carrying momentum through the corners and making smart decisions on the track.

Speeds in Different Racing Environments

Let's break down speeds you might encounter in various dirt midget racing scenarios:

  1. Short Tracks (1/4 to 1/3 mile): On these tighter ovals, you'll see midgets reaching speeds around 80 to 100 miles per hour on the front and back straights. The focus here is on rapid acceleration out of corners and maintaining momentum through the turns.
  2. Half-Mile Ovals: These larger tracks allow for higher speeds, with midgets often exceeding 110 to 125 miles per hour on the straights. The longer straights enable the cars to build up more velocity before braking for the turns.

The Importance of Cornering Speed

It's crucial to understand that dirt midget racing isn't just about straight-line speed. The ability to carry speed through the corners is paramount and often more indicative of a winning car and driver combination. Drivers are constantly looking for the fastest line, which often involves drifting the car up the track and then diving down into the corner, a technique known as "riding the cushion." This requires immense skill and bravery, as a slight miscalculation can lead to a spin or a crash.

What About Quarter Midgets?

It's important to distinguish between full-size dirt midgets and their smaller counterparts, quarter midgets. Quarter midgets are designed for younger drivers and run on much smaller tracks, typically 1/16th to 1/4 mile. Their speeds are significantly lower, generally topping out around 30 to 45 miles per hour. The focus here is on teaching fundamentals and safe racing practices.

Frequently Asked Questions about Dirt Midget Speed

How do dirt midgets achieve such high speeds on dirt?

Dirt midgets achieve high speeds through a combination of powerful engines, lightweight construction, and specialized tires designed for grip on loose surfaces. The banking of the tracks also helps cars carry momentum through the turns.

Why are dirt midgets not faster than IndyCars?

IndyCars are designed for much higher speeds on larger, often paved ovals and road courses. They have more aerodynamic downforce, more powerful engines, and run on different tire compounds suited for pavement, allowing them to achieve significantly higher top speeds.

What is the typical horsepower of a dirt midget engine?

A typical dirt midget engine will produce between 300 and over 400 horsepower. These are potent engines in a relatively small and lightweight chassis.

How does track condition affect a dirt midget's speed?

Track condition is critical. A "heavy" or "moist" track offers more grip, allowing for higher speeds. A "slick" or "dry" track reduces grip, forcing drivers to be more cautious and slowing down overall speeds.
